Understanding the Problem: Why Isn't My PayPal Working?
Before we jump into solutions, let's understand why your Nintendo PayPal might not be working. There are several reasons this could happen, and identifying the root cause is the first step to fixing it. Often, it's something simple that can be easily resolved. Here are some common culprits:
- Incorrect PayPal Information: This is the most common reason. A simple typo in your email address or password can prevent the connection. Always double-check the information you've entered.
 - Billing Address Mismatch: Your PayPal billing address must match the address associated with your Nintendo account. Any discrepancy can cause issues.
 - Insufficient Funds: This might seem obvious, but it's easily overlooked. Ensure your PayPal account or linked bank account has sufficient funds to cover the purchase.
 - PayPal Security Measures: PayPal has security measures in place to prevent fraud. If they detect suspicious activity, they might block the transaction.
 - Nintendo eShop Server Issues: Sometimes, the problem isn't on your end. The Nintendo eShop servers might be experiencing technical difficulties.
 - Outdated Nintendo Account Settings: Old or outdated account settings can sometimes interfere with payment methods. This is especially true if you haven't updated your account in a while.
 - Regional Restrictions: In some cases, there might be regional restrictions that prevent you from using PayPal in certain countries or regions.
 - Linked Account Problems: If your PayPal is linked to a bank account or credit card, issues with those accounts can affect your PayPal transactions.
 - Browser or Device Issues: Sometimes, the problem lies with the browser or device you're using to access the eShop. Cached data or outdated software can cause conflicts.
 - VPN or Proxy Issues: Using a VPN or proxy server can sometimes interfere with PayPal's ability to verify your location, leading to transaction failures.
 
By understanding these potential issues, you can better target your troubleshooting efforts. Now, let's move on to the solutions!
Basic Troubleshooting Steps
Okay, let's start with some easy fixes. These are the first things you should check when your Nintendo PayPal isn't cooperating. Sometimes, the simplest solution is the right one!
- 
Double-Check Your PayPal Information:
- Email Address: Ensure you've entered the correct PayPal email address. A single typo can cause the transaction to fail.
 - Password: Make sure you're using the correct PayPal password. If you're unsure, try resetting it.
 - Billing Address: Verify that the billing address in your PayPal account matches the address associated with your Nintendo account. Discrepancies can lead to payment issues.
 
 - 
Verify Funds in Your PayPal Account:
- Sufficient Balance: Ensure your PayPal account has enough funds to cover the purchase, including any applicable taxes.
 - Linked Bank Account/Card: If your PayPal is linked to a bank account or credit card, check that those accounts are also in good standing and have sufficient funds.
 
 - 
Check Nintendo eShop Server Status:
- Nintendo's Website: Visit Nintendo's official website or their social media channels to check for any reported server outages or maintenance.
 - Third-Party Websites: Use third-party websites that track server status for online games and services.
 
 - 
Restart Your Device:
- Nintendo Switch: Power off your Nintendo Switch completely, wait a few seconds, and then turn it back on.
 - Other Devices: If you're using a computer or mobile device, restart it to clear any temporary glitches.
 
 - 
Try a Different Browser or Device:
- Browser: If you're using a browser, try a different one (e.g., Chrome, Firefox, Safari). Clear the cache and cookies in the browser you're using.
 - Device: If you're using a computer, try using your Nintendo Switch or mobile device, and vice versa.
 
 
These basic steps can often resolve common issues. If your Nintendo PayPal is still not working, don't worry! We have more advanced solutions to try.
Advanced Troubleshooting Methods
Alright, if the basic steps didn't do the trick, let's move on to some more advanced troubleshooting methods. These might require a bit more effort, but they can often resolve more complex issues with your Nintendo PayPal connection.
- 
Link and Unlink Your PayPal Account:
- Unlink: Remove your PayPal account from your Nintendo account.
 - Relink: Re-add your PayPal account, ensuring all information is entered correctly.
 - Verification: Follow any verification steps provided by PayPal to confirm the connection.
 
 - 
Update Your Nintendo Account Information:
- Personal Information: Ensure your name, date of birth, and other personal information are accurate and up-to-date.
 - Address: Confirm that your address matches the billing address in your PayPal account.
 
 - 
Contact PayPal Support:
- Help Center: Visit PayPal's Help Center for troubleshooting articles and FAQs.
 - Customer Support: Contact PayPal's customer support team via phone, email, or chat for personalized assistance.
 
 - 
Contact Nintendo Support:
- Nintendo Support Website: Visit Nintendo's support website for troubleshooting guides and FAQs specific to Nintendo products and services.
 - Customer Service: Contact Nintendo's customer service team via phone or chat for assistance with your Nintendo account and eShop.
 
 - 
Check for Regional Restrictions:
- PayPal's Policy: Review PayPal's policy regarding regional restrictions and ensure your location is supported.
 - Nintendo's Policy: Check Nintendo's policy on regional compatibility and payment methods.
 
 - 
Disable VPN or Proxy:
- VPN/Proxy Settings: Disable any VPN or proxy servers you're using and try the transaction again.
 - Location Services: Ensure location services are enabled on your device to help PayPal verify your location.
 
 - 
Review PayPal Security Settings:
- Security Alerts: Check your PayPal account for any security alerts or notifications that might be blocking the transaction.
 - Transaction Limits: Ensure you haven't exceeded any transaction limits set by PayPal.
 
 
By trying these advanced methods, you'll cover a wide range of potential issues. If you're still running into problems, it might be time to seek professional help from PayPal or Nintendo support.
Preventing Future Issues
Now that we've covered how to fix your Nintendo PayPal issues, let's talk about preventing them in the future. Here are some tips to keep your PayPal and Nintendo accounts happy and working together seamlessly:
- Keep Your Information Updated: Regularly review and update your PayPal and Nintendo account information, including your email address, password, billing address, and payment methods.
 - Monitor Your Accounts: Keep an eye on your PayPal and Nintendo account activity for any unauthorized transactions or suspicious activity.
 - Use Strong Passwords: Use strong, unique passwords for both your PayPal and Nintendo accounts. Consider using a password manager to help you create and store secure passwords.
 - Enable Two-Factor Authentication: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) for both your PayPal and Nintendo accounts to add an extra layer of security.
 - Avoid Public Wi-Fi: Be cautious when using public Wi-Fi networks, as they can be less secure. Use a VPN or a secure, private network when making online transactions.
 - Stay Informed: Stay up-to-date on the latest security threats and scams related to online payments and gaming accounts.
 - Regularly Clear Cache and Cookies: Regularly clear the cache and cookies in your browser to prevent conflicts and ensure optimal performance.
 - Check for Software Updates: Keep your device's operating system and browser up-to-date to ensure compatibility and security.
 
By following these tips, you can minimize the risk of encountering issues with your Nintendo PayPal connection in the future. A little bit of prevention goes a long way!
